Expoint - all jobs in one place

The point where experts and best companies meet

Limitless High-tech career opportunities - Expoint

Cisco Software Engineer C++ TCP/IP 
India, Karnataka, Bengaluru 
403654254

14.04.2025

Responsibilities:

  • Design, develop, and maintain software for cloud security solutions that address modern challenges in cloud infrastructure and application security.
  • Write clean, maintainable, and efficient code while adhering to best practices for security, performance, and scalability.
  • Collaborate with product managers, designers, and other engineers to build and improve features with a focus on security and compliance.
  • Troubleshoot, debug, and optimize security products to ensure high availability, reliability, and performance.
  • Participate in code reviews and design discussions, providing thoughtful feedback and suggestions for improvements.
  • Implement and maintain security controls, monitoring, and alerting mechanisms within cloud environments.
  • Work closely with operations and infrastructure teams to ensure smooth deployment and integration of security products into customer environments.
  • Take ownership of features or modules from concept to deployment, ensuring they meet product and security requirements.
  • Participate in the on-call rotation to provide timely and effective support for production issues, particularly those affecting security and networking components.
Qualifications:
  • 5-10 years of professional software engineering experience, with a focus on cloud security or networking software development.
  • Strong understanding of networking principles, protocols (TCP/IP, DNS, HTTP/S, etc.), and troubleshooting techniques.
  • Experience with cloud platforms (AWS, Azure, Google Cloud) and their associated features and services.
  • Proficiency in at least one programming language, such as C, Python.
  • Familiarity with version control (Git), and agile software development methodologies.
  • Excellent problem-solving skills and ability to troubleshoot complex technical issues.
  • Strong ownership mindset, with the ability to manage tasks independently and contribute to the continuous improvement of the product.
  • Strong collaboration skills and a positive attitude toward working with cross-functional teams. Willingness to share knowledge, help others, and contribute to a team-oriented culture.
Preferred Qualifications:
  • Experience with on-call duties and managing production incidents in a timely and effective manner.
  • Experience with cloud-native security tools (e.g., cloud firewalls, DDoS protection, IAM, VPC security, etc.).
  • Experience with automation tools like Terraform, Ansible, or CloudFormation for infrastructure-as-code and CI/CD pipelines.
  • Comfortable in a fast-paced, dynamic environment where priorities may shift quickly. Able to adapt to new technologies and evolving business needs.
  • Solid understanding of security best practices in cloud-native applications, encryption, and access controls.